titleOfInvention | Use of benzoylguanidine for the treatment of non-insulin-dependent diabetes mellitus |
abstract | (57) Abstract: The present invention relates to benzoylguanidines of the formula I And / or their physiologically acceptable salts and solvates for the manufacture of a medicament for the treatment of non-insulin dependent diabetes mellitus.
